Global Manifold Absolute Pressure Sensor Market - Key Trends & Drivers Summarized

Why Are Manifold Absolute Pressure Sensors Gaining Popularity?

Manifold absolute pressure sensors are critical components in automotive engine management systems, ensuring optimal air-fuel mixture control and emissions regulation. As global vehicle emissions standards become stricter, the demand for high-precision pressure sensors is increasing.

The transition toward electric and hybrid vehicles is also influencing sensor technology, with manufacturers developing pressure sensors that enhance battery management systems and optimize fuel efficiency in hybrid engines.

How Are Innovations Enhancing the Performance of Manifold Absolute Pressure Sensors?

Advancements in microelectromechanical systems technology are improving sensor accuracy, durability, and response times. The integration of artificial intelligence-based diagnostics is also enhancing real-time monitoring capabilities, allowing for predictive maintenance and improved vehicle performance.

The development of high-temperature-resistant and miniaturized pressure sensors is expanding their application in advanced powertrain systems and off-road vehicles. Additionally, wireless connectivity features are enabling real-time sensor data transmission for remote diagnostics.

What Are the Key Market Drivers?

Stringent vehicle emissions regulations, the growing adoption of electric and hybrid vehicles, and the increasing demand for fuel-efficient engine management systems are driving market growth. The expansion of automotive electronics and smart vehicle technologies is also boosting demand for advanced manifold absolute pressure sensors.

Additionally, the rise of connected car ecosystems and telematics integration is increasing the need for pressure sensors that can communicate with cloud-based analytics platforms. The shift toward autonomous vehicle technology is further pushing manufacturers to develop high-precision sensor solutions.

What Challenges and Future Opportunities Exist?

Challenges include the high cost of advanced sensor technologies, integration complexities with next-generation powertrains, and supply chain disruptions in semiconductor manufacturing. However, opportunities exist in the expansion of artificial intelligence-driven sensor calibration, the adoption of smart diagnostics for vehicle maintenance, and the development of energy-efficient pressure sensor solutions for sustainable mobility.
